Crispy bacon, salty cheese, and fresh parsley stuffed into Rhodes soft dinner rolls.

Ingredients
12Rhodes frozen dinner rolls
6slicesbacon, cooked & crumbled
1/2cupfresh parsley, chopped
1cupAsiago cheese, shredded
2tablespoonsbutter, melted

Instructions
Grease a 9 by 13 inch pan.
Add rolls to pan, cover with sprayed plastic wrap, and put in the fridge overnight (or leave on counter for 3 hours) to thaw and rise. Note--if your rolls haven't risen but have thawed completely you can still move on to the next step.
Gently press a nest into the rolls.
Divide the bacon, cheese, and parsley amongst the 12 rolls and stuff them. Save a small amount of each for the top of the rolls.
Gently pull the tops of the rolls together to close them as best you can.
Pour the melted butter over the top of the rolls.
Cover and let rise until double in size, about 45 minutes. --see notes in post about speeding this process, if needed.
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.
When risen, sprinkle the remaining cheese, bacon, and parsley over the top.
Bake at 350 degrees for about 45 minutes or until deeply golden brown.
